Bill Summary
Amends the Illinois Vehicle Code. Provides that a person may reassign his or her registration plate to another person. Provides that, if a person who has a registration plate in his or her name seeks to reassign the registration plate to another person (rather than his or her spouse or child), the Secretary of State shall waive any transfer fee or vanity or personalized registration plate fee.
AI Summary
This bill amends the Illinois Vehicle Code to allow individuals to reassign their vehicle registration plates to another person, not just their spouse or child. Previously, the law primarily focused on individuals reassigning their plates for their own future use or to a spouse or child, with specific fee waivers for those transfers. Now, if someone wishes to transfer their registration plate to someone other than a spouse or child, the Secretary of State will waive any transfer fees or fees associated with vanity or personalized plates, provided both parties sign a form authorizing the reassignment. This change broadens the scope of who can receive a reassigned registration plate and simplifies the process by removing the previous restrictions and associated fees for transfers to non-family members.
